Honda Other description

Meet your new favorite bike

Part of the new CTX® series, the CTX®700N offers a laid-back riding position with more forward-set hand controls and footpegs, and a low 28.3-inch seat height. And we didn’t forget the tech: there’s an available automatic (DCT) transmission and ABS version for smooth shifting and strong stopping in less than ideal conditions. Both versions feature the fuel-efficient 670cc twin-cylinder engine in our award-winning NC700X®.

Incredible Technology, Incredible Value

The CTX®700N offers an automatic transmission and ABS version at a low price. With the DCT automatic transmission, you can shift with the push of a handlebar-mounted button, or select the automatic mode and the bike will shift itself. Plus, you get Anti-Lock Brakes for improved stopping in less than ideal conditions.

Comfortable Cruising

Honda®’s new CTX® series is all about making motorcycling fun and accessible. The CTX®700N’s relaxed riding position and low seat help achieve this goal.

Your Power Partner

The CTX®700N’s 670cc liquid-cooled parallel-twin engine produces tons of torque and enough power for easy two-up cruising. Honda® twins are famous for their wide powerbands and efficiency, and this new engine is one of our best.

Convenient Storage

We want the new CTX®700N to be a bike you’ll want to ride every day, not just on weekends. That’s why we went out of our way to design user-friendly features like the integrated storage—perfect for items you need to access fast.

WSBK 2013: Moscow Race Report

Mon, 22 Jul 2013

Marco Melandri captured his third win of the season, the Ducati 1199 Panigale scored its first podium while Sylvain Guintoli regained the championship lead despite dislocating his collarbone days before the race. But the big news at Moscow Raceway of course was the tragic death of Andrea Antonelli in the World Supersport race. The opening-lap crash in severely wet conditions naturally led to the cancellation of the rest of the events as the World Superbike community mourns the loss of the 25-year-old Antonelli.
